## Deployment: Order Cutoff Rule

This section explains how the Crumbwell storefront enforces the daily order cutoff. Orders placed after the cutoff roll to the next baking day automatically, and customers see a banner explaining the change before checkout. Support staff should know that the cutoff is evaluated in the bakery's local timezone, not the customer's, and that holiday calendars can move it earlier. When the scheduler service starts, it loads the cutoff behavior from the following configuration values.

config for kafof-bawef:
holath:
  log_level: debug
  metrics_host: metrics.holath.qorvelsys.internal
  pin: 2191
  pool_size: 32

Internal Memo — Budget Request

To the sales leads: Operations has submitted a budget request to fund two additional demo kits for the Vellane product line and travel support for the Ashgrove territory push. Finance expects a decision within two weeks. No changes to current spending limits until then; log any urgent needs with your regional coordinator. Background on the request's purpose appears below.

board note of fahaf-fadug: Gilixax Logistics is in early talks to buy Praiusax Partners for about $8.1 million. The Pramir launch date is September 23, and nothing goes to the press before then.

**Q: What data does the Hallowmere parity checker actually store?**

A: The checker retains only normalized rate snapshots: property identifier, room category, date range, channel name, and the quoted price. It does not store guest data, booking records, or channel credentials; scraping sessions use short-lived tokens issued by the Brelin vault and discarded after each run. Retention is 90 days, after which snapshots are purged. The data-flow diagram and token lifecycle details are maintained on the internal page here.

operations page: https://jira.qorvelsys.internal/browse/pages/browse/pages